Our verdict is Uncertain significance. Variant got 2 ACMG points: 2P and 0B. PM2
The NM_022114.4(PRDM16):c.2060G>C(p.Gly687Ala) variant causes a missense change. The variant allele was found at a frequency of 0.0000131 in 152,196 control chromosomes in the GnomAD database, with no homozygous occurrence. Variant has been reported in ClinVar as Uncertain significance (★). Synonymous variant affecting the same amino acid position (i.e. G687G) has been classified as Likely benign.

Variant classified as Uncertain Significance - Favor Benign. The p.Gly687Ala var iant in PRDM16 has not been previously reported in individuals with cardiomyopat hy or in large population studies. Glycine at position 687 is not highly conser ved in mammals or evolutionarily distant species and one mammal (rabbit) and ten species of fish carry an alanine (Ala) at this position, raising the possibilit y that this change may be tolerated. In summary, while the clinical significance of the p.Gly687Ala variant is uncertain, these data suggest that it is more lik ely to be benign. -
